Onboarding note: Marzipan Lane Bakery enforces a 14:00 order cutoff. Orders after cutoff roll to the next business day via the Ovenline scheduler. The cutoff rule is evaluated server-side by the internal cutoff-service; clients must never compute it locally. Reviewers verifying this flow will need authenticated access to that service. The credential for the cutoff-service is as follows.

gateway credential: kto23_LX9A4ys6i4nzHtpOLNLodKK

**Ticket: Config drift blocking Hermitage migration**

The Cobblestone build has drifted from its checked-in configuration. Three machines in the Fernvale pool carry locally patched toolchain paths, so Hermitage's hermetic sandbox fails reproducibility checks against them. Before the migration can proceed, the canonical configuration must be restored everywhere and the local overrides deleted. For reference by future maintainers, the canonical values Hermitage expects are recorded below.

config for kafof-bawef:
holath:
  log_level: debug
  metrics_host: metrics.holath.qorvelsys.internal
  pin: 2191
  pool_size: 32

Action item from the Lanternbird outage review: the Kestrel and Wren client SDKs drifted — Kestrel shipped retry jitter in v3.2 but Wren never got it, which amplified the thundering-herd during the incident. On-call should audit the parity matrix monthly until automation lands, and flag any gap older than one release. The current matrix and audit checklist are maintained on the internal page here:

wiki page, tahaf-tajog: https://jira.ordindyn.corp/pipeline

## Onboarding: Payroll Export v3 — Thistledown Pay

v3 exports switch from fixed-width to signed JSON lines. Every export batch is signed before leaving the export node. Review scope: signing config only; field mappings are out of scope. The signing key lives solely in the export node's env file, never in the repo. The relevant line follows.

vault entry, yaguf-hahag: VAULT_KEY8=c6b2dc56

## v2.8.1 — Key rotation

Feedproof (podcast feed validator) rotated its release signing key following the quarterly audit. Old key revoked, trust bundle updated, verification tests adjusted to expect the new fingerprint. No functional changes to validation rules. Reviewer: please confirm the revocation entry and that CI picks up the new trust store. For reference during review, the new signing key is included below.

deploy key for kajof-fajop: bky6_gDHw9Q